Introduction
The Town of Truro has allocated financial resources to clear a wooded site adjacent to Millbrook First Nation following reports of safety hazards and criminal activity.

Main Body
The Truro town council has authorized an expenditure of up to $50,000 for the removal of debris from a multi-acre tract of municipal land. This administrative action follows the identification of significant wildfire risks, evidenced by the presence of campfire pits and a recent nearby fire, as well as reports from local commercial entities regarding property thefts. The site contained makeshift shelters and various discarded materials; while the evacuation is largely complete, minimal occupancy was noted during recent observations.

Institutional perspectives on the crisis diverge between immediate risk mitigation and long-term systemic failure. Mayor Cathy Hinton characterized the expenditure as a necessary measure to prevent fatalities and safeguard the community, noting that this represents the first instance of municipal funding for such a cleanup. Conversely, the Truro Housing Outreach Society, represented by Stephanie Watson, posits that the recurrence of such encampments is inevitable absent the provision of permanent, supportive housing. Watson cited a confluence of prohibitive rental costs, low vacancy rates, and a deficit of specialized resources for mental health and substance use disorders as primary drivers of homelessness, noting an increasing trend of seniors entering the shelter system due to economic displacement.

Existing infrastructure remains insufficient to address the current demand. The Haven House facility maintains a waitlist exceeding its total capacity, and while the Souls Harbour Rescue Mission reports sporadic bed vacancies, the overall availability of supportive housing remains constrained. Mayor Hinton has indicated that any viable resolution necessitates the integration of on-site clinical services, and she maintains ongoing consultations with provincial authorities and service providers to establish a sustainable framework.

Vocabulary Learning
The Architecture of Institutional Neutrality
To transition from B2 (competent) to C2 (mastery), a student must move beyond mere 'vocabulary' and begin analyzing Register Shift and Nominalization. This text is a masterclass in Administrative Euphemism—the art of using high-register, Latinate abstractions to distance the writer from the visceral reality of the subject matter.
◈ The Nominalization Pivot
Notice how the text avoids active verbs that imply agency or emotion. Instead, it employs "nominals" (turning actions into nouns) to create an aura of objectivity:
- Instead of: "The town decided to spend money..."
- The C2 approach: "The Truro town council has authorized an expenditure..."
By transforming the verb spend into the noun expenditure, the writer shifts the focus from the act of spending to the administrative category of the event. This is the hallmark of legal and governmental discourse.
◈ Lexical Precision: The 'Latinate' Ladder
C2 mastery requires selecting words that carry a specific "weight" of formality. Compare these clusters found in the text:
| B2/C1 Equivalent | C2 Institutional Equivalent | Linguistic Effect |
|---|---|---|
| Fixing/Cleaning | Remediation | Implies a professional, technical restoration. |
| A mix of causes | A confluence of... | Suggests a complex, intersecting flow of factors. |
| Not enough | Constrained | Moves from a quantity deficit to a systemic limitation. |
| Moving people out | Evacuation | Shifts the frame from "homelessness" to "emergency management." |
◈ Syntactic Density & The 'Abstract Subject'
Observe the sentence: "Institutional perspectives on the crisis diverge between immediate risk mitigation and long-term systemic failure."
Here, the subject is not a person, but an "Institutional perspective." This is a sophisticated rhetorical move. It allows the writer to present conflict not as a fight between people (Hinton vs. Watson), but as a divergence of conceptual frameworks.
The Mastery Takeaway: To write at a C2 level in professional or academic contexts, cease describing what people do and start describing how systems operate. Replace emotive verbs with precise, nominalized Latinate structures to achieve "Institutional Neutrality."
